Serie A Weekend Recap: Results & Model Review (Sep 11–14, 2026)
The results
Here is how the Serie A weekend (Sep 11–14, 2026) played out — every result set against the model's pre-match lean. Bottom line: the model's 1X2 lean called 0 of 7 results. All season-long numbers for the league: Serie A hub.
- Venezia FC 2–4 ACF Fiorentina — model lean: the draw (58%) ❌
- Genoa CFC 1–1 Frosinone Calcio — model lean: Frosinone Calcio (58%) ❌
- SS Lazio 2–2 AC Milan — model lean: SS Lazio (54%) ❌
- Atalanta BC 1–2 Cagliari Calcio — model lean: Atalanta BC (49%) ❌
- US Lecce 3–2 AC Monza — model lean: the draw (56%) ❌
- SSC Napoli 1–0 Bologna FC 1909 — model lean: the draw (58%) ❌
- US Sassuolo Calcio 3–2 Juventus FC — model lean: the draw (49%) ❌

An honest read
One weekend is a tiny sample: 7 games tell you almost nothing about model quality — calibration across hundreds of matches does. That is why we grade ourselves on the open, running track record, not on a single round.
